KR> Engine Failure on Take OFF.

2011-09-26 Thread Phil Matheson
Well, it can happen to you.

Last night 1730 at 500 ft Engine stopped dead. Lack of landing spots. Had to
make 150' turn to safe ground.

Check, tanks pumps NO start, but engine wind milling. A bit hot and ran out
of field, had to lift over fence, then channel, stall, O S*#T - ground.
Bugger.

Walked away. KR home in my workshop.

Damage,
Prop, nose wheel collapse, L main collapse. Under inner wing whole from
wheel. But main leg undamaged, the main bolts Sheared OFF, as did the nose
wheel to fire wall bolts. NO cowl damage only paint. Engine mount bent.  

FOUND the cause this morning, the coil lead came out of the distributor Cap.
No wonder it would not start.
Did I seem Mark Jones make a cover or his dist. cap, Should listen to Mark.

Impact point Google Earth  145 32.527 E 35 39.681S only 400m from my home.

KR> Re:Up Date

2008-10-12 Thread Phil Matheson
Well I can not believe how quiet the net is.

I have been modifying my cowl to suit my engine air in takes, as my RG 2000 
has a gear drive, the engine sits lower in the cowl and the cowl in lets are 
to high for a good direct flow, as well the inlets need to be low enough to 
have a ramp so the air can climb up hill to get to the barrels. This ramp 
allows a more direct and better cooling when the KR is in it's nose high 
climb configurations.

So I cut out the old in lets last night and glassed over them, now I have to 
cut out new in lets and flare and glass them.

As my engine has twin Stromberg Carbs with the oil dampened slides, the carb 
oil level has to checked before each flight or the carb will NOT get full 
throttle. I cut three inspection hatches in the top of the cowl, 2 for the 
carbs and 1 for the oil dip stick.
Then !   hopefully the cowl can be painted, the barrel shrouds finished, 
and that will be it, all Finished, except for the C of A

KR> Roll over Pertection

2008-10-12 Thread Phil Matheson
This is the requirement for a roll over bar, as per regs

" The structure must be designed to protect the occupant in a complete 
turnover, assuming, in the absence of a more rational analysis:-"
(1) An upwards ultimate inertia force of 3g's ; and
(2) A coefficient of friction of 0.5 at the ground.

SO, KR2 of
1000 lbs weight  X 3 g's = 3000 lbs,
times 0.5 =  1500lbs. force hitting you bar.

Then remember that you plane is then sliding backwards over the ground?? so 
the force is then trying to push the bar onto YOU. ( that's why I have two 
cables back to the tail bulk head).

So, IS can your glass roll over protection strong enough???

Always ask someone qualified, who knows.

KR> Fire Retardant Resin Additive

2008-10-12 Thread Phil Matheson
This is a copy of an email I sent to all Aussie KR guys, Hope you find it of 
interest. You will get this additive in the USA.

Alumina Triydrate ( Google this for more info)

This is a Powder that is mixed with Fiber Glass resin and stops the glass
from burning when the flame is removed. You can mix and make a complete cowl
or paint the inside to give some protection.

Cost $10.00 per Kg, mix 25 :1 weight.

KR> Belt Drive PSRU

2008-10-12 Thread Phil Matheson
Up date

My engine has been returned to VW Engines to have a problem fixed with the 
oil Cooler set up. (a damaged  fitting in the block that needed some work.)

Ron Slender has phoned to say that VW Engines will not be making anymore 
Helical Geared PSRU. ( Geared Drives)
Instead, because of the cost of production and they are trying to stay 
competitive, They will be using a belt drives from now on.

He offered me a great deal to change it over to belt drive while he has the 
engine.
This is worth some thought, has it will save weight, less moving , and 
wearing parts, less noise, vibration and harmonics, as well as less service 
costs.

Belts should last ??? 500 hours plus

Comments for far have been positive.

What do you guys in the know think??

So I need to make up my mind quickly.

So I will be working to have the airframe finished when the engine returns 
in a few weeks.

VW Engines have yet to update their web page to reflect this yet, as these 
things take time.

Retail Cost of the Belt PSRU should be out soon if anyone is interested., 
But  I would think they will only be available for the Type 4 rear 
drive.,but I will let you know soon.

KR> Intake Manifold - Oil cooler relocation.

2008-10-12 Thread Phil Matheson
Dan
Before I mounted my cooler under and behind the engine, I was going to mount 
it flat against the firewall ( or about 1 inch or so off it)and use the fire 
wall as the outlet, allowing the air to run down the firewall and exit out 
the bottom.( with a light guard)
OR
I was going to mount if on it's edge, on the firewall  running along side 
the cowl, with air inlets as I have on my cooler now, and have the outlet 
through the back edge of cowl on one side, and add exit slots like you see 
in the Vintage Car bonnet. I would seal outlet to cooler with foam, so the 
cooler would not be removed with cowl.

I would have braced the cooler to the firewall and off the engine mount.
